Teaching Methodologies and Assessment Criteria |
The pedagogical method adopted in the course unit is Project-Based Learning, which involves research, critical reading and analysis of texts, teamwork, and the development of activities in the classroom. In this course unit, seminars will also be held with specialists in the studied topics who have both field and research experience in these areas.
Given the specificity of the course unit, students will be required to:
a) Research various topics, concepts, authors, and current trends in Theories of Social Exclusion;
b) Investigate and read about specific issues in contemporary societies that stem from social exclusion;
c) Present and discuss the results of their research;
d) Critically support a point of view during presentations;
e) Understand the importance of knowledge sharing in the classroom;
